About

Seung‐Hee Lee is a scholar working on Ocean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Civil and Structural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Seung‐Hee Lee has authored 74 papers receiving a total of 433 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Ocean Engineering, 17 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 14 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ering. Recurrent topics in Seung‐Hee Lee’s work include Engineering Applied Research (14 papers), Ship Hydrodynamics and Maneuverability (11 papers) and Marine and Coastal Research (6 papers). Seung‐Hee Lee is often cited by papers focused on Engineering Applied Research (14 papers), Ship Hydrodynamics and Maneuverability (11 papers) and Marine and Coastal Research (6 papers). Seung‐Hee Lee coll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and China. Seung‐Hee Lee's co-authors include Charles U. Pittman, Seok‐Bong Heo, Joong Hee Lee, Zhihao Zhang, Rory Ma, Tae Kyu Kim, Yu‐Jin Kim, Hanbit Park, D. Amaranatha Reddy and Jane E. Workman and has published in prestigious journals such as Polymer, Chemistry - A European Journal and Cell Reports.
